Do you believe every child deserves to be fully included at camp? JCC Greater Boston is looking for caring, patient, and enthusiastic Advocate Camp Counselors to join our School Break Camps (December, February, Passover, and April school breaks).
Advocate Counselors are part of our camp’s Inclusion Team, working directly with campers with disabilities and individualized needs. Guided by ICPs (Individual Camper Plans) and supported by our Inclusion Team, Advocate Counselors partner with co-counselors to ensure that every camper is safe, supported, and fully included in their bunk and camp activities.
What you will do each day:
Each morning, you’ll connect with your camper, making sure they feel welcomed and ready for the day. You’ll support them in joining their bunk for activities – whether that means going over the schedule with them, cheering them on during sports, modeling skills and providing hands-on support in arts & crafts, or being in the water with them at swim. Throughout the day, you’ll model patience, empathy, and creativity as you help campers navigate challenges and celebrate successes. You’ll work closely with co-counselors and our Inclusion Team to adapt supports as needed. At the end of the day, you’ll leave knowing you made camp possible for a child who might not otherwise be able to fully participate.

Primary responsibilities include, and are not limited to:
- Partner with co-counselors to build an inclusive group dynamic and implement accommodations from camper ICPs
- Advocate for camper strengths, needs, and abilities while encouraging independence and participation
- Support campers in fully engaging with bunk life and activities (arts, sports, swimming, special events)
- Ensure the safety and well-being of campers during structured and unstructured times
- Participate in and support campers during swim times (must be able to access the pool and swim with campers)
- Communicate regularly with co-counselors and leadership to ensure consistency of support
- Model patience, empathy, and positive behavior for campers and peers
